Maharashtra Congress ministers to donate salaries towards free COVID-19 vaccine drive

Thorat's sugar cooperatives will also give the amount needed for the inoculation of 5,000 employees to the CMRF.

The Maharashtra Congress on Thursday said state minister and senior party leader Balasaheb Thorat will donate a year's salary to the Chief Minister's Relief Fund (CMRF) for the free COVID-19 vaccination drive to be undertaken in the state.

In an official statement, the party said other Congress ministers and legislators will also contribute a month's salary towards the cause.
